APR | Fixed rates, varying from 4.45% to 8.24%; |
Loan Purpose | Student Loans, Refinance of Student Loans, Parent Loans, and Certificate Loans.; |
Loan Amounts | Up to $45,000 (with a maximum of $175,000 per family); |
Credit Needed | At least 680; |
Origination Fee | None; |
Late Fee | The late fee amount varies and will be specified in your loan contract; |
Early Payoff Penalty | None. |
Is the RISLA Student Loan a good option?
The Rhode Island Student Loan Authority (RISLA) offers student loan programs designed to assist individuals in financing their higher education.
As a state-based nonprofit organization, RISLA aims to provide accessible and affordable loan options to Rhode Island residents and non-residents.
With the aim of expanding access to higher education, RISLA always seeks to offer the lowest rates. Their go is not to profit from you. Instead, they’ll help you!
You’ll also get flexible repayment options and borrower benefits such as no origination fees and potential loan forgiveness.
By supporting students in their educational pursuits, RISLA serves as a valuable resource for individuals seeking financing for their college or university education.

The pros and cons of the RISLA Student Loan
Every time you’re getting a loan, you must pay close attention to both pros and cons. And to assist you, we’ve made a list to review the key aspects of RISLA Student Loan:
Advantages
- RISLA sparks your financial journey with competitive interest rates that blaze a trail, often outshining those offered by private lenders;
- Also, they provide educational resources, tools, and workshops. Additionally, you’ll get college planning resources to make well-informed decisions about your higher education;
- And to save money for better purposes, you’ll get your loan with zero fees. RISLA spares you from upfront fees;
- Moreover, the fixed rates will help you budget, having greater predictability in the installments of your loan;
- Finally, when unexpected circumstances threaten your financial stability, RISLA is there to support you with forbearance and income-based repayment options.
Disadvantages
- The loan amounts offered by RISLA Student Loan may be lower than other loans;
- Also, RISLA lack of more diverse terms options. You can only choose between a 10 or 15 years repayment plan, no shorter or longer than this.
What credit score do you need to apply?
It’s advisable to have a good credit score, typically above 650, to increase your likelihood of approval and secure more favorable loan terms.
Additionally, RISLA considers various factors beyond credit scores, including income, employment history, and debt-to-income ratio, when evaluating loan applications.
